
Introduction to Strength Training

Strength training is a crucial component of fitness that involves using resistance to induce muscular contraction, leading to increased strength, endurance, and overall fitness. For beginners, starting this journey at home can be both convenient and effective.

Essential Equipment for Home Strength Training

While it’s possible to perform bodyweight exercises, some essential equipment can enhance your training:
- Dumbbells: Versatile and great for a variety of exercises.
- Resistance Bands: Ideal for strength training without heavy weights.
- Yoga Mat: Provides comfort for floor exercises.
- Stability Ball: Useful for core workouts and balance improvement.

Creating a Workout Routine

To develop a balanced workout routine, consider the following tips:
- Frequency: Aim for at least 2-3 days of strength training per week.
- Repetitions: Start with 8-12 repetitions for each exercise.
- Rest: Allow time for muscle recovery between sessions.
- Progression: Gradually increase weights or resistance as you become stronger.
